Чему равно значение переменной s после выполнения данного алгоритма? алг сумма квадратов (цел s) рез s нач нат n s : =0 для n от 1 до 3 нц s : =s+n кц кон а) 24 б) 16 в) 10 г) 6
Число авс может принимать значение от 123 до 987 исходя из этого пишем программу var ast,bst,cst,s: string; i,a,ab,abc,bcb: integer; f: boolean; {признак того, что решение найдено} begin for i: =123 to 987 do begin if f=false then begin s: =inttostr(i); ast: =s[1]; bst: =s[2]; cst: =s[3]; a: =strtoint(ast); ab: =strtoint(ast+bst); abc: =strtoint(ast+bst+cst); bcb: =strtoint(bst+cst+bst); if a+ab+abc=bcb then f: =true; if (s[1]=s[2]) or (s[1]=s[3]) or (s[2]=s[3]) then f: =false; {цифры не должны повторяться} end end; if f=true then writeln(a,'+',ab,'+',abc,'=',bcb) else writeln('решения нет') end.
corneewa20096
23.04.2022
Var a, b, c: byte; begin for a : = 0 to 9 do for b : = 0 to 9 do for c : = 0 to 9 do if (a + single.parse(a.tostring() + b. + single.parse(a.tostring() + b.tostring() + c. = single.parse(b.tostring() + c.tostring() + b. then begin writeln(string.format('{0} + {0}{1} + {0}{1}{2} = {1}{2}{1} | a = {0}; b = {1}; c = {2}', a. b. c.; end; end.
Ответить на вопрос
Поделитесь своими знаниями, ответьте на вопрос:
Чему равно значение переменной s после выполнения данного алгоритма? алг сумма квадратов (цел s) рез s нач нат n s : =0 для n от 1 до 3 нц s : =s+n кц кон а) 24 б) 16 в) 10 г) 6